Abstract

The utility model discloses an assembled building construction fence, which comprises a base and a fence, wherein the middle position of the upper end of the base is provided with a mounting groove, the fence is fixed in the mounting groove through a plurality of groups of mounting mechanisms, each mounting mechanism comprises a mounting plate extending from the lower end of the fence, two side positions of the bottom of the mounting plate are provided with fixing grooves, a pair of clamping blocks are slidably mounted in the fixing grooves, the inner side of each clamping block is provided with a threaded groove, each threaded groove is internally threaded with a threaded rod, the inner side end of each threaded rod is also provided with a fourth bevel gear, a second rotating shaft is further rotatably mounted in the mounting plate, a third bevel gear is fixed at the lower half part of the second rotating shaft and is meshed with two corresponding fourth bevel gears, the structure of the utility model is simple, the repeated utilization of fence construction can be realized, and improve its stability, effectively prevent that the construction rail from taking place to empty.

Background
The construction enclosure is a temporary wall body which needs to be set up in the building or municipal construction operation process, and the construction enclosure isolates the construction operation site from the external environment, so that the construction site becomes a relatively closed space, the exposure of noise, dust and messy conditions in the construction process is avoided, and the safe and civilized construction is ensured. Preferably, the connecting mechanism comprises a plurality of connecting blocks extending from one side of the base and a connecting groove arranged at the corresponding position of the other side of the base, and the corresponding positions of the connecting blocks and the connecting groove are provided with fixing holes.
Compared with the prior art, the utility model has the beneficial effects that: the construction fence is fixed by arranging the connecting mechanism to match with the auxiliary mechanism and the mounting mechanism, so that the stability of the construction fence is improved, the construction fence is easy to disassemble and assemble, the repeated utilization can be realized, and the resource consumption is greatly reduced. The construction fence has a simple structure, can be recycled, improves the stability, and effectively prevents the construction fence from toppling.

By arranging the auxiliary mechanism 4, the stability between the rails 7 can be improved, and in use, an auxiliary rod is placed in the auxiliary clamp 41 of the adjacent rail 7, and then the auxiliary bolt 42 is screwed, so that two ends of the auxiliary rod 43 are respectively fixed on the two rails 7.
The auxiliary clip 41 is L-shaped.
The connecting mechanism 2 comprises a plurality of connecting blocks 21 extending from one side of the base 1 and a connecting groove 23 formed in the corresponding position of the other side of the base, and fixing holes 22 are formed in the corresponding positions of the connecting blocks 21 and the connecting groove 23. Through setting up coupling mechanism 2, can improve the stability between the base 1, during the use, insert the connecting block 21 of base one end in the spread groove 23 of another base 1, insert the fixed bolt and can realize fixing in fixed orifices 22 afterwards.
The working principle of the utility model is as follows: when in use, firstly, the connecting block 21 at one end of the base is inserted into the connecting groove 23 of another base 1, then the fixing bolt is inserted into the fixing hole 22 to realize fixing, then the mounting plate 56 is inserted into the mounting groove 6 of the base 1, the through hole on the fixing seat 32 is aligned with the fixing screw hole 33, then the fixing bolt 31 is screwed to realize fixing, next, the hand wheel 51 is rotated to drive the first rotating shaft 52 to rotate, meanwhile, the first bevel gear 53 on the first rotating shaft drives the second bevel gear 54 to rotate, further, the second rotating shaft 55 is rotated, further, the third bevel gear 57 is driven to rotate, the third bevel gear 57 drives the two fourth bevel gears 58 to rotate, further, the clamping block 59 is moved outwards to extend into the grooves at two sides of the mounting groove 5 to complete fixing, and finally, the auxiliary rod is placed into the auxiliary clamping clip 41 of the adjacent fence 7, subsequently, the auxiliary bolt 42 is tightened to fix both ends of the auxiliary rod 43 to the two rails 7, respectively.
